How the Custom Packaging Process Works for Memorable Product Packaging
Figuring out how to design memorable product packaging starts with a disciplined, traceable flow down the Custom Logo Things line, and after every briefing meeting, we map that flow so nothing falls through the cracks; the West Warehousing team in Milwaukee records every action on a 15-point checklist before the corrugator sees the dieline. I always remind the crew that the corrugator doesn’t care about PowerPoint promises, so we meet the factory first and the renderings second.
The journey begins in Greenwood, Indiana, where our creative directors lock into the client brief, reviewing any packaging design research, shelf photos, and consumer personas before any dieline moves. Within 48 hours of that kickoff, a structural engineer has sketched three concept dielines in CAD using ArtiosCAD, vetted for valve placement and shipping stackability, and shared PDFs for approval. While the design team layers branded packaging color systems, the project manager feeds specs to the prepress crew; we expect their full press-ready files 5–7 days later for structural prototyping, a stage that often uncovers surprises when the dieline meets real corrugate or 18-pt SBS board on the Custom Logo Things pilot press. I’m usually the one pacing the hallway in that window between briefing and prototype, convinced we forgot an embossing call out until the sample proves otherwise.
The next phase runs 7–10 days on print trials. The Flexo Lab takes the approved art, calibrates the K-155 press, and runs short sheets to validate ink density, registration, and texture treatments such as soft-touch lamination or spot UV; those trials typically require 60 sheets per variation, and we log Delta E readings for each run. Because we manage color with automated ink management tied to our X-Rite spectrophotometers, we usually hit Delta E within 1.5 on the first pass, which minimizes the rounds of corrections for the printers and the designer. The inline quality cameras flag registration slippage greater than 0.25 mm, so we keep the palette and tactile cues consistent across the run, meaning the brand voice and the boardroom checklist come together with the reliability we demand. One time a sheen test looked stunning until someone accidentally knocked the lamination rollers—ugh, still a vivid frustration—and we learned to stop feeding coffee cups into the same conveyor as the samples.
Production and shipping normally take 2–3 weeks once the print trials are signed off, and we often overlap tasks to honor aggressive launches; for a recent Chicago-bound retail rollout we started palletizing the final 1,200 boxes the same afternoon the die set was cleared. For example, while our warehousing team preps the shipping pallets, the finishing group can run foils, embossing, or die-cuts on a parallel line so the moment the press sheets are dried, they slide directly into finishing. That overlap, along with diligent traceability reports, keeps the answer to “how to design memorable product packaging” practical for every client moving from prototype to full pallet shipment, especially when clients expect trucks to depart within 12-15 business days from proof approval. Key Factors That Shape how to design memorable product packaging
Picking the right substrate is a foundational decision when you want to understand how to design memorable product packaging, because it determines the tactile story before any brand narrative arrives, and a 350gsm C1S artboard may be the perfect canvas for a premium fragrance while a coated unbleached kraft from the Fox Valley supply houses the same scent with rustic authenticity. I remember the day a skincare client insisted on metallic board, only to discover that a soft, fibrous SBS selection made their messaging feel genuine and grounded; the substrate became part of the story, not just a cost-line item.
For premium cosmetics, we often push solid bleached sulfate (SBS) with 350 gsm for the cover and 120 gsm for the inside so the box snaps into shape without cracking at the glue flap, allowing the 2-pt silver foil logos and matte aqueous coatings we plan to run on the Heidelberg to sit flush. That choice lets us layer multiple finishes—soft-touch lamination on the exterior, a 2-pt silver foil for logos, and a matte aqueous coating on the interior without worrying about warping. In contrast, artisan food brands lean on kraft or recycled ECOS boards from the Carolinas, which communicate sustainability and rustic charm while keeping the flexural rigidity necessary for retail packaging displays; those suppliers ship FSC-certified loads with COA that arrive within 5 days of ordering. Each substrate also carries recycling codes and FSC certifications; our suppliers in the Fox Valley and the Carolinas send certificates that we archive for clients referencing sustainability goals. Honestly, I think those certification packets deserve their own filing cabinet at this point.
Structural engineering also drives the experience. Tuck-end two-piece cartons give a sleek reveal when the lid lifts, while auto-bottom designs juggernaut through e-commerce fulfillment because they arrive pre-glued and ready to ship; a recent food brand asked for a B-flute auto-bottom that could handle 12 oz jars, so we specified micro-flute liners for extra support. Triple-wall corrugate, which we regularly source from the same Oshkosh partner who supplies the corrugator, is deployed for heavy equipment parts, and its thick C-flute maintains crush resistance while still allowing for impactful package branding with latex inks; that board typically weighs 0.55 pounds per square foot. Decisions on fluting (B, C, E) and cell board gulp thickness are not purely structural—they influence the “unboxing experience,” how the panel drapes across the retail shelf, and how supporting copy or tactile embossing works in harmony. (Yes, I watch those unboxing videos in my spare time just to remind myself how people actually interact with the package.)
Finishing touches, like lamination types, UV coating, and hot stamp foils, answer the question: what sensory note ties the product to its story? On the K-155 press, we can stack soft-touch lamination with 24K gold foil in a single pass, but we always run budgeted samples first so the artwork and adhesives (we prefer Henkel Loctite adhesives for their quick set) match across the run; that sample costs roughly $75 and takes three hours to execute. We advise clients to treat these finishes as narrative cues rather than decor; a single spot UV patch over the brand icon can deliver more memorability than saturating the entire surface with foil, especially when cost-conscious budgets demand judicious placement. The moment you mix structural engineering, tactile choice, and finishing strategy, you grasp how to design memorable product packaging that aligns with both brand promise and production reality. Budgeting and Pricing Considerations for Memorable Product Packaging
Understanding how to design memorable product packaging means knowing how every budget decision affects the unit cost, including board grade, ink coverage, finishing, and run length; for instance, an SBS-covered matchbox-style pack on 350 gsm costs about $0.78 per unit at 10,000 pieces using a Milwaukee-based litho press, while a recycled 18-pt rigid setup box with hot foil and embossing runs closer to $1.15 per piece at that quantity when pressed in Chicago. Ink coverage, especially large solids, adds roughly $0.08 per square inch because of the increased drying time and additional press passes, so we often recommend layering textures or matte coatings instead of saturating the entire panel with color. Run length is also key; tooling costs are typically amortized over the run, so shorter lots on a diecut tubular may carry $0.25 higher tooling per unit than a 20,000-piece run on standard litho-laminated cartons—but the short run gives you room to test finishes or seasonal branding. I get grumpy when someone waits until the proof is out to ask about tooling—trust me, the numbers stubbornly refuse to behave at that point.
Our pricing team at Custom Logo Things offers transparent estimates that show each line item, including glue type (we include the cost of Henkel aqua-hybrid adhesives when applicable) and finishing steps. To keep costs predictable, lock down dielines early, batch finishing steps, and, when possible, stay within standard sizes that keep board waste down. Parallel tasks, such as prepping shipping pallets while the finishing line runs, also reduce soft costs like warehousing and expedite total time to retail; for projects shipping to Boston or Atlanta, we routinely save 4–6 hours per pallet with this overlap.
| Option | Run Length | Price Per Unit | Notable Features |
|---|---|---|---|
| Diecut Tubular | 5,000 units | $0.95 | Solid board, glue flap, soft-touch lamination available |
| Litho-Laminated Carton | 20,000 units | $0.61 | High opacity, metallic inks, inline UV finish |
| Rigid Setup Box | 1,500 units | $2.25 | Magnetic closure, foil stamping, bespoke inserts |
When deciding whether to invest in premium finishes or tooling—for example, a custom embossing die ($4,500) versus a UV spot varnish ($0.12 per square inch)—ask what the customer will remember first. Sometimes a single tactile cue on the front panel is more impactful than hitting every surface with foil, and that restraint is what keeps priced-per-unit numbers reasonable while still teaching everyone how to design memorable product packaging that sells. Common Mistakes When Trying to Design Memorable Product Packaging
One of the most frequent missteps is inundating a box with copy; I’ve been in too many boardroom reviews where a brand wanted to say everything on the front panel, and the result was visual noise that shoved aside structural cues. The better move is to pair a clear structural “hero” area with prioritized messaging, leaving the inner panels for additional storytelling. That way, consumers understand the brand message in seconds while still discovering depth inside—something that branded packaging needs to respect. Honestly, it drives me a little crazy when we have to peel back layers of copy after the die is already programmed.
Another error is skipping real-world testing. On a job for a boutique beverage brand, the digital mockup looked flawless, but when the sample left the Custom Logo Things pilot press, the top tab wanted to fold early because the adhesive weight was off by 0.5 mm and the board was slightly bowed after a humid Milwaukee summer day. Because we insisted on running a physical prototype, we caught it before a full production run that would have led to crushed retail packaging and expensive rework. Always validate with samples from the same machines that will handle your production order to keep how to design memorable product packaging grounded in reality. (If I had a dollar for every time a digital-only proof failed, I’d buy a new set of embossing dies.)
Last-minute material swaps also cause trouble. Changing the stock the week before press creates havoc for procurement teams, displaces freight, and risks missing FSC or sustainability targets; that’s why we hold a material lock deadline 14 days before press, especially for clients shipping out of Los Angeles or Toronto who need expedited trucking. A consistent material call keeps vendors aligned and avoids the weeks of scheduling headaches I’ve seen when clients add a new laminate or refinish request too late in the process.
